Transaction 61ae9493414d05feab33bc84aec3dff7892e67a5c299fc5ea4875b943a4cd8d3

1 Input
2 Outputs
  • 61ae9493414d05feab33bc84aec3dff7892e67a5c299fc5ea4875b943a4cd8d3:0
  • value  9128043
    address  32Es6nhkesX38n3oySU9Pc3PYUtNA3wBcS
  • 61ae9493414d05feab33bc84aec3dff7892e67a5c299fc5ea4875b943a4cd8d3:1
  • value  2529944
    address  389fS3jg3xwD3om8zjD9utnsUr5iAhSs8e